摘要
rnary copper(II) complexes involving polypyridyl ligands in the coordination sphere of composition [Cu(tpy)(phen)](ClO4)(2) (1), [Cu(tpy)(bipy)](ClO4)(2) (2), [Cu(tptz)(phen)]ClO4)(2) (3) and [Cu(tptz)(bipy)](BF4)(2) (4) where tpy = 2,2':6',2"-terpyridine, tptz = 2,4,6-tfi(2pyridyl)- 1,3,5-triazine, phen = 1, 1 0-phenanthroline and bipy = 2,2'-bipyridine have been synthesized and characterized by elemental analysis, magnetic susceptibility, X-band e.p.r. spectroscopy and electronic spectroscopy. Single crystal X-ray of (1) has revealed the presence of a distorted square pyramidal geometry in the complex. Magnetic susceptibility measurements at room temperature were in the range of 1.77-1.81 BM. SOD and antimicrobial activities of these complexes were also measured. Crystal data of (1): P- 1, a = 9.3010(7),angstrom, b = 9.7900(6) angstrom, c = 16.4620(6) angstrom, V-c = 1342.73(14) angstrom(3), Z= 4. The bond distance of Cu-N in square base is 2 +/- 0.04 angstrom. (c) 2005 Elsevier B.V. All rights reserved.
